This booklet, Action Plan for Enduring Prosperity: A Strong, Stable and Competitive Financial System, is a chapter of the full report of the Business Council of Australia’s Action Plan for Enduring Prosperity.

The action plan identifies 93 recommendations across nine policy areas that can deliver prosperity through well-managed growth. This booklet is focused on a strong, stable and competitive financial system.

A stable and well-regulated financial system helps the economy grow and prosper by spreading risks more efficiently and by facilitating the funding of productive investments. Australia’s capital markets have a very solid foundation and will provide a strong underpinning to our future growth prospects.

We need to maintain confidence in the financial markets and find the right balance between stability and system resilience on the one hand and competition and productivity in the sector on the other.

The booklet also contains a suggested approach to the phasing of the policy recommendations and an assessment of their ease of implementation versus their overall importance.
